pump definition - medical
pump (pŭmp)
noun- A machine or device for raising, compressing, or transferring fluids.
- A molecular mechanism for the active transport of ions or molecules across a cell membrane.
- To raise or cause to flow by means of a pump.
- To transport ions or molecules against a concentration gradient by the expenditure of chemically stored energy.
